Peach Trees

Peach trees are renowned for their stunning blossoms in spring and delicious fruit during summer. Typically, you can enjoy peaches in just two years from planting. Not only are they beautiful, but they also thrive in sunny environments and well-drained soil.

Apple Trees

These classic favorites can start producing fruit as early as the second year. Apple trees come in various varieties, many of which are disease-resistant, making them a smart choice for beginner gardeners. Look for dwarf varieties if space is limited—they’re ideal for smaller backyards!

Cherry Trees

Who doesn’t love cherries? These trees are not only fast-growing but also charming with their stunning springtime blossoms. After about two years, you can look forward to your first sweet cherries, especially if you’re opting for the right varieties like the ‘Stella’ cherry.

Fig Trees

Fig trees are quite unique, offering delicious fruits perfect for snacking or desserts. They love warm climates, and many varieties can bear fruit within just 1-2 years. Once they start producing, you’ll find them to be quite generous!

Lemon Trees

Imagine having lemons at your fingertips for your next glass of lemonade or lemon tart. Lemon trees can deliver fruit quickly, often as soon as they are two years old! They thrive in pots, making them perfect for patios or balconies.

Pear Trees

With their sweet and juicy fruits, pear trees are another fantastic option. They can start yielding fruit in as little as two years, and many cultivars are relatively low-maintenance, requiring just a bit of pruning here and there.

Selecting the Right Location

Before you plant, think about where you want your tree to go. Most fruit trees thrive in full sun, so choose a location that receives at least 6 to 8 hours of sunlight daily. Ensure that the area has good drainage and is shielded from strong winds.

Planting Techniques

Start by digging a hole that is twice as wide and the same depth as the root ball of your tree. Untangle any roots and place the tree in the center. Fill the hole with soil, water it thoroughly, and apply mulch around the base to retain moisture. Make sure to water the tree deeply once a week, particularly during dry spells.

Maintenance Tips

Regular care is key to keeping your trees healthy. Ensure they receive ample water, especially in the first couple of years. Pruning during dormancy (late winter or early spring) can promote healthier growth and maximize harvests. Don’t forget to check for pests and diseases regularly, and take action promptly if you spot any issues.

Potential Challenges and How to Overcome Them

While planting fruit trees can be rewarding, it’s important to be aware of potential challenges. For example, young trees are susceptible to pests like aphids and spider mites. Implementing organic pest control methods can keep your trees healthy without harmful chemicals.

Additionally, proper drainage is crucial. If your soil tends to stay wet after rain, consider creating a raised bed to aid water movement. The aim is to ensure your fast-growing trees thrive rather than struggle from poor conditions.

FAQs

What is the best time to plant fruit trees?
Spring or fall is typically the best season to plant fruit trees, allowing them to establish roots before the heat of summer or the cold of winter.

Do I need more than one fruit tree to produce fruit?
Some fruit trees, like apples, require cross-pollination with other varieties for a successful harvest, while others, like figs, can self-pollinate.

Are fast-growing fruit trees more prone to disease?
Not necessarily, but young trees can be more susceptible. With proper care and early pest management, they can be healthy and productive.

How big will these trees get?
Varies by species; however, many fast-growing fruit trees can be kept small through pruning, especially dwarf varieties.

Can I grow these trees in pots?
Yes, many of these varieties like lemon and peach trees can thrive in pots, making them suitable for patios or small spaces.
